Products search
Search
866-290-1410
Menu
Skip to content
Skip to content
Menu
home
products
Free Catalog
about
Resources
Contact
0
DLCT
Posted:
on
December 2, 2024
Source Image:
Full resolution (474 × 473)
Image navigation